Owner/Operator markings of facilities include the use of paint, flags, stakes, whiskers, or a combination to identify the facility(ies) at or near an excavation site. Marks in the appropriate color are approximately 12”-18” long and 1”wide, spaced approximately 4 ft - 50 ft apart.
